In Sydney and NSW regional ...The Family Home Guarantee allows single parents to purchase a home with as little as a 2% deposit without paying Lenders Mortgage Insurance (LMI). Under the scheme, up to 18% of a single parent's home loan can be guaranteed by the Government. LMI is usually payable on home loans with deposits of less than 20%.

Department of Housing.Aug 8, 2023 · Single parent home loans are generally perceived by lenders as being higher risk than standard home loans. That’s because there is only one income to service the loan repayments, not two. Ways that you can lower the lender’s risk include: increasing your deposit. borrowing less. having a guarantor for your loan. Communities First Ohio DPA. FHA home loans are loans backed by the Federal Housing Authority (FHA) and are offered to first-time buyers or people who haven’t owned a home for three years. These loans have flexible income eligibility requirements and only requires a 3.5% down payment for borrowers with a minimum credit score of 580.Madison first-time home buyers. For the Family Home Guarantee, the applicant must be a single parent or single legal guardian with at least one dependent child; The Guarantee will only apply to Owner Occupied home loans paid on a principal and interest basis (investment properties and Interest Only loans are excluded).
